A little more serious...
PB4 is not yet ready to go in Beta stage, I guess you all know this by now.
This is not just an update....this is a huge compiler rewrite...
But as i see it now, Fred will be only a couple of weeks wrong with the "maybe xmas present" he said in the interview.
Everything Fred wanted to change and add to the compiler is done. (also lots of bugs added)
Now the Debugger, libs and IDE have to be reworked to work with that compiler.
Note: JaPBe will not work, so maybe a couple of ppl can start to study the code to make all necesary changes if you want to keep on using it. Changing the VD code to PB4 syntax took me only about 4 hours (24000 lines)
So get ready to start betatesting, this will be the biggest betatest in PB history, never before where there so much changes!
